Re: [Phpslash-devel] was: How to add a module?
Brought to you by:
joestewart,
nhruby
From: Joe S. <joe...@us...> - 2003-11-06 16:03:08
|
On Thu, Nov 06, 2003 at 04:01:19PM +0000, Peter Cruickshank wrote: > On Thursday 06 Nov 2003 3:11 pm, Joe Stewart wrote: > > On Wed, Nov 05, 2003 at 10:27:54PM +0000, Peter Cruickshank wrote: > ... > <snip> > > I think it would be useful at some point to turn on the debug in pslNew, and > see if objects are being created sensibly. Seemed to me there's a lot of > duplicate instantiation going on, and not just of slashDB (tho that's the one > with the big implications). > I've been playing with xdebug some too to see where maybe some bottlenecks are. Nothing concrete yet except loading all the classes from disk. This is where phpaccelerater, apc, etc. provide what php is missing that python provides built in. > Still, this has implications for how the basic block engine works - maybe not > for now... I think it is due a revist tho - it's been with us since I started > being interested in this project, way back in '00. > yes. It's very important the block code is optimized now since it displays everything. > One thought for example - I think it would make things run smoother if column > was moved from block_options to being it's own field in psl_block - column > has got a lot more central to PSL's operations over the years) > At one time this was big on my list. I can't remember why not now except that it's easy now to give different choices for individual sites. Joe > P > |